JSP JDBC дизайн доступа к данным - PullRequest
1 голос
/ 20 января 2011

Привет: У меня есть вопрос о том, как спроектировать и отобразить класс объекта в java с базой данных (sql).

Например, если у меня есть класс клиента и заказ, которые соответствуют таблице клиентов и заказов в базе данных,Если мне нужна информация о Заказчике и Заказе отдельно, я просто использую SQL-запрос для извлечения информации из таблицы базы данных и помещаю их в Список и Список и отображаю в приложении переднего плана.Что если мне нужно отобразить, чтобы одновременно отображать информацию о клиенте и заказе?Как поместить объект Customer и Order в один и тот же массив?

Если кто-нибудь может помочь мне ответить на этот вопрос в jsp или asp.net, я буду признателен.

Спасибо

Ответы [ 2 ]

1 голос
/ 20 января 2011

Первый - не делайте этого в jsp. Делайте это в обычном классе, вызываемом сервлетом / контроллером. Тогда взгляните на некоторые ORM - hibernate, eclipselink. Но это может быть слишком сложно для простого проекта. Также посмотрите на commons-dbutils.

0 голосов
/ 20 января 2011

Один из возможных подходов состоит в создании объекта переноса, который включает в себя необходимую информацию от обоих объектов, и помещения TO в список.

Проверьте http://java.sun.com/blueprints/corej2eepatterns/Patterns/TransferObject.html и http://en.wikipedia.org/wiki/Data_transfer_object для получения дополнительной информации по этому шаблону.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...